Comprehending the Types of UK Driving Licences
The DVLA (Driver and Vehicle Licensing Agency) issues various categories of driving licences depending on the type of lorry you wish to drive. For most personal vehicle drivers, the Category B licence is the appropriate one, which covers vehicles up to 3,500 kgs maximum authorised mass (MAM) with approximately 8 guest seats. This classification includes the standard manual and automatic automobiles that the bulk of learners spend their time studying for.
Beyond Category B, the UK driving licence system consists of many other classifications for motorcycles, buses, goods cars, and farming machinery. Those interested in riding motorbikes should pursue Category A, which is more subdivided into automatic access for smaller bikes and direct access for bigger devices after fulfilling particular age requirements. Expert driving categories require additional testing and credentials beyond the standard automobile licence process.
The Step-by-Step Process to Obtaining Your Licence
The pathway to a complete UK driving licence follows a structured development that every prospect should browse in order. Understanding this sequence assists aiming drivers prepare their journey successfully and prevent unnecessary hold-ups or issues along the way.
The process starts with applying for a provisionary driving licence once you reach the minimum age of 15 years and 9 months. This provisional licence permits supervised driving practice just, requiring the presence of a qualified chauffeur aged 21 or over who has actually held a complete licence for at least 3 years. During this provisionary duration, candidates should pass 2 major tests before getting their complete licence: the theory test and the practical driving test.
Scheduling and passing the theory test represents the next turning point in the journey. This test comprises 2 elements: a multiple-choice area covering road safety understanding, traffic indications, and driving theory, followed by a risk understanding test analyzing the candidate's capability to recognize and respond to developing risks on the roadway. When the theory test is passed, that certificate stays legitimate for 2 years, during which time the prospect should pass the useful driving test.
The practical driving test evaluates your capability to run a lorry safely in various roadway and traffic conditions. This test consists of an eyesight check, vehicle security concerns, and around 40 minutes of driving that consists of independent driving, reversing maneuvers, and possibly emergency stop procedures. Upon effective conclusion, the inspector will issue a pass certificate, and you can then obtain your full driving licence.
Essential Requirements and Eligibility Criteria
Before starting the application procedure, candidates must ensure they fulfill the basic requirements set by the DVLA. The minimum age for holding a provisionary licence for automobiles and bikes is 15 years and nine months, though you can not take the practical driving test for a cars and truck till you turn 17. For motorcycles, the minimum age differs depending upon engine size and the specific category being sought.
Identity documents forms a crucial part of the application procedure. Candidates must provide legitimate proof of identity, which generally includes a UK passport or a complete birth certificate combined with another form of recognition. Those who have actually altered their name through marital relationship or deed poll need to offer supporting documents. Address verification requires two documents from an approved list, such as bank statements, energy costs, or council tax letters, dated within the last 3 months.
Medical fitness is another crucial factor to consider, as particular medical conditions can impact eligibility to drive. The DVLA requires declaration of any medical conditions that might hinder driving ability, including epilepsy, particular heart conditions, diabetes needing insulin treatment, and different neurological conditions. Most conditions do not always disqualify candidates but might need medical documents or professional evaluations before a licence can be issued.
Associated Costs and Fees Breakdown
Comprehending the monetary investment required assists prospects spending plan appropriately for their driving journey. The following table outlines the primary fees associated with acquiring a basic Category B driving licence in Great Britain.
| Cost Type | Existing Cost |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Provisional Licence Application | ₤ 19.50 | Online applications; ₤ 22.00 if applied by post |
| Theory Test | ₤ 23.00 | Includes both multiple-choice and threat perception |
| Practical Driving Test | ₤ 62.00 | Weekday daytime test; ₤ 75.00 for evening and weekend |
| Driving Instructor Hourly Rate | ₤ 25-₤ 35 | Varies by area and instructor experience |
| Extended Test (if required) | ₤ 124.00 | For candidates requiring extra testing |
These costs represent the main DVLA and DSA (Driving Standards Agency) costs just. Extra costs for driving lessons, practice lorries, and theory test preparation products ought to be factored into the total budget plan. Many students require between 20 and 50 hours of expert direction integrated with personal practice, suggesting overall expenses typically range significantly depending upon specific ability and local lesson rates.

Frequently Asked Questions
The length of time does it require to get a UK driving licence from start to finish?
The timeline differs significantly depending upon specific scenarios, but most students finish the procedure within six to twelve months. This consists of time for discovering to drive, passing both tests, and processing the licence application. Those with exceptional preparation and regular practice might achieve this much faster, while others taking less frequent lessons may extend the procedure considerably.
Can I drive with an EU or global licence in the UK?
Licence holders from EU or European Economic Area nations can drive in the UK using their existing licence without requiring to exchange it. Those with licences from specific other nations may drive for up to 12 months before needing to get a UK licence, though particular rules depend upon the nation's licensing contract with the United Kingdom.
What takes place if I fail my driving test?
A failed test does not require waiting on any compulsory duration before rebooking. Candidates can schedule another test once they feel effectively prepared, though the useful test charge must be paid once again for each effort. The majority of candidates hand down their second or third effort, though some require extra practice and numerous tries.
Do I require to take lessons with an expert instructor?
While professional lessons are not legally required, the Driving Standards Agency highly suggests discovering with an authorized instructor. Instructors are trained to determine and correct driving faults effectively and guarantee prospects satisfy the required requirement for safe independent driving. Lots of insurance coverage suppliers also use lower premiums for drivers who have actually received expert training.
